Edgar Meyer matters for the way he reshapes the possibilities of string instruments, especially the double bass, inviting listeners to reconsider its role beyond traditional contexts. His bridge between classical finesse and bluegrass sensibility creates an opening for new dialogues in music, where genres converge and redefine each other. This not only broadens the audience's appreciation of instrumental prowess but also elevates the conversation about what contemporary composition can achieve. Meyer’s approach is defined by his virtuosic technique combined with a deeply intuitive understanding of rhythm and melody. He often collaborates with musicians across various genres, creating a tapestry of sound that incorporates elements of improvisation, which infuses each performance with spontaneity and excitement. By fusing intricate classical arrangements with the raw energy of bluegrass, he crafts an engaging listening experience that feels both grounded and exploratory. His songwriting often weaves narratives of place and emotion, touching on themes of connection to nature, personal reflection, and the interplay between tradition and innovation. The tone tends to be conversational yet profound, drawing listeners into stories without heavy-handedness, allowing impressions to linger rather than dictating meaning outright.
